As the Manager, Pricing you'll join Loblaw's Pricing Team, a group of analytical and results-driven professionals responsible for delivering competitive, accurate, and strategic pricing across our retail division. Reporting to the Director of Pricing, you'll collaborate with partners across merchandising, category, and store operations to ensure decisions and processes reflect consistency, compliance, and integrity.

What You'll Do:



Support Stores & Partners:

Quickly resolve pricing or promotional issues impacting stores, customers, and cross-functional partners.

Execute Pricing Strategy:

Maintain pricing accuracy, compliance, and guardrails across all retail channels.

Collaborate Cross-Functionally:

Work weekly with category and merchandising teams to review, approve, and implement pricing changes.

Manage Reporting & KPIs:

Own group-level pricing and promotion reports and dashboards--running regular checks and balances, tracking key metrics, and ensuring timely updates with actionable insights.

Lead Deep-Dive Analysis:

Perform ad-hoc investigations into pricing and promotional performance to identify root causes, trends, and improvement opportunities.

Ensure Governance & Data Integrity:

Uphold audit standards and data governance to maintain accuracy and regulatory compliance.

Drive Process Improvements:

Lead or contribute to cross-functional projects aimed at streamlining pricing and promotional operations.

What You Bring:



Retail Acumen:

Solid understanding of retail operations, category management, and competitive pricing dynamics.

Analytical Strength:

Strong quantitative and problem-solving skills, comfortable interpreting large datasets to drive decisions.

Technical Proficiency:

Advanced Excel skills; experience with SAP, SQL, Teradata, Python, SAS, or Power BI is an asset.

Organized & Agile:

Exceptional time management with the ability to prioritize multiple projects and meet tight deadlines.

Collaborative Mindset:

Strong relationship-building skills to influence and partner with cross-functional teams.

Continuous Improvement Focus:

Curious, proactive, and driven to refine processes and deliver measurable business value.
